Jogging routes around Piennes-Onvillers traverse a rural commune in the Somme department, characterized by the natural regions of Santerre and Amiénois. The landscape features a gently undulating elevation, ranging from 82 to 119 meters, providing varied inclines. Runners can expect scenic paths through open agricultural fields, offering expansive views. The area also includes natural highlights like calcareous grasslands and wooded valleys, providing diverse environments for running.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in the Piennes-Onvillers area?

There are over 60 running routes around Piennes-Onvillers, offering a wide variety of options for different fitness levels and preferences. These include easy, moderate, and difficult trails.

What kind of terrain can I expect on jogging routes around Piennes-Onvillers?

The jogging routes in Piennes-Onvillers feature a diverse landscape. You'll find gently undulating paths through expansive agricultural fields, offering open views. There are also routes that traverse wooded valleys, such as the nearby Vallée des Trois Doms, providing shaded and picturesque environments. Some areas, like the Montagne de Fignières, offer unique calcareous grasslands and remarkable panoramic views.

Are there routes suitable for beginners or easy runs in Piennes-Onvillers?

Yes, Piennes-Onvillers offers several easy running routes. For instance, the Château de Sorel loop from Orvillers-Sorel is an easy 4.8 km trail that takes about 31 minutes to complete, leading through areas near historical sites.

What do other runners say about the routes in Piennes-Onvillers?

The routes in Piennes-Onvillers are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.8 stars from more than 15 reviews. Nearly 300 runners have explored the varied terrain, often praising the tranquil agricultural vistas and the diverse natural features.

Are there any scenic running trails with good views in the region?

Absolutely. Many routes offer scenic views, particularly those through the open agricultural fields. For truly remarkable panoramas, consider trails that pass near the Montagne de Fignières (Le Larris du Brûlé), known for its elevated position and expansive vistas over the surrounding countryside.

Can I find longer, more challenging running routes in Piennes-Onvillers?

Yes, for those seeking a greater challenge, there are several difficult routes. The VBois de Gueule – Château de Sorel loop from Conchy-les-Pots is a challenging 19.5 km route with significant elevation changes, perfect for a longer, more strenuous run.

Are there any circular jogging routes available?

Many of the routes in the Piennes-Onvillers area are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. An example is the Running loop from Ételfay, a moderate 10.1 km path that offers a complete circuit through the local landscape.

Is Piennes-Onvillers suitable for family-friendly jogging?

Given the prevalence of easy and moderate trails, and the generally gentle undulating landscape, Piennes-Onvillers can be suitable for family-friendly jogging. Look for shorter, less strenuous routes, especially those through quiet country paths, to enjoy with children.

Are dogs allowed on the running trails in Piennes-Onvillers?

While specific regulations can vary, generally, dogs on a leash are welcome on most public trails in rural areas like Piennes-Onvillers. It's always advisable to keep your dog under control, especially when passing through agricultural fields or near livestock, and to clean up after them.

What is the best season for jogging in Piennes-Onvillers?

The spring and autumn months are generally ideal for jogging in Piennes-Onvillers, offering p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ery. Spring brings blooming flora, especially in areas like the calcareous grasslands, while autumn showcases vibrant foliage in the wooded valleys. Summer can also be enjoyable, particularly in the shaded sections of trails, but be mindful of warmer temperatures.

Are there any jogging routes that pass by historical sites or landmarks?

Yes, some routes incorporate historical elements. For instance, the Château de Sorel loop from Orvillers-Sorel takes you through areas near historical sites, offering a blend of natural beauty and cultural interest during your run.

How long are the typical jogging routes in this area?

The jogging routes around Piennes-Onvillers vary significantly in length. You can find shorter, easy routes around 4-5 km, such as the Château de Sorel loop. Moderate routes typically range from 8-10 km, like the Running loop from Ételfay. For longer runs, there are difficult trails extending up to 19 km.
